So it’s been three and a half years since my radical prostatectomy. How am I doing?
Status
PSA remains undetectable.
Incontinence
Stress incontinence remains a minor issue for me–sneezing or coughing are the worst, especially if I’m standing. If I’m seated, it’s less of an issue. The vast majority of days for me are “dry” days, but there’s an occasional day where I guess my body is tired and I’m a little more prone to issues.
Sexual Function
Remember that they took one of my nerve bundles, but I have to admit that I’m pleased with my progress without the use of a pill, slow as it has been.
I can achieve about an 80% to 90% erection under my own power most of the time. My urologist offered up a vacuum pump as an option during my last visit, and I declined for now.
Orgasms for me are pretty much the same as they were pre-surgery, although perhaps just a tad shorter in duration and less intense.
Summary
Overall, I’m pleased with where I’m at–cancer-free and pretty much back to normal functioning with minimal inconveniences.
